Adding a fountain or waterfall to your garden or water feature will give it a much more lush appearance. Fountain and waterfall pumps can be expensive, but they are definitely worth the investment if you want to create a beautiful space that guests will love.
There are many plants that grow quickly in moist soil. Some good options are irises and lilies. Iris roots will easily penetrate moist soil, and lilies can grow quickly in a garden bed with plenty of water.

To add an element of beauty to your landscape, consider installing a water feature with several large fountains spouting jets of water in different directions. This will create a peaceful and inviting atmosphere that can enhance the appearance of your property. Choose a fountain style that best suits your home's layout and design preferences, and be sure to include a filter system to ensure clean water always flows.

Water lilies or duckweed can be planted in the shallows near the edge of the pond to create an aquatic border. Alternatively, consider floating plants such as water hyacinth, lily pads, or cattails. These plants will help to clean the water and provide a natural habitat for fish and other aquatic life.
